An old, local name for this Pokémon is "Keokeo", referring to its white pelt. While it is not suited to warmer environments, its tail can produce ice to lower the surrounding temperature if needed. Alolan Vulpix can expel breath as cold as -58☏ (-50☌), which is capable of freezing anything. It can be found in small packs, called skulks, that are led and protected by Ninetales.

Alolan Vulpix is believed to have arrived in the region at the same time as humans but moved to the snow-capped mountain to avoid other Pokémon. The locks of hair on its head and its six tails are curlier and have a wispy appearance. Its snout is more pronounced and pointed than that of non-Alolan Vulpix. It has pale blue paws, blue eyes, and dark blue insides its ears. In the Alola region, Vulpix has adapted to snowy mountain peaks and developed a snowy white pelt. Vulpix can be found most commonly in grassy plains. Vulpix is known to feign injury to escape from opponents too powerful for it to defeat. When the temperature outside increases, it will expel flames from its mouth to prevent its body from overheating. Inside its body is a flame that never goes out. These wisps are sometimes mistaken for ghosts by humans, but Vulpix uses them to assist in catching prey. Vulpix is capable of manipulating fire to such precision as to create floating wisps of flame. The tails grow hot as it approaches evolution. However, Vulpix is born with only a single, white tail that splits as Vulpix grows. On top of its head are three curled locks of orange fur with bangs, and it has orange tails with curled tips. Its paws are slightly darker than the rest of its pelt and have light brown paw pads.

It has brown eyes, large, pointed ears with dark brown insides, and a triangular dark brown nose. It has a red-brown pelt with a cream-colored underbelly.
